8PSB.DE vs. IWVL.L
8PSB.DE (Invesco Physical Silver ETC) and IWVL.L (iShares Edge MSCI World Value Factor UCITS ETF USD (Acc)) are both exchange-traded funds - 8PSB.DE is a Silver fund tracking the LBMA Silver Price, while IWVL.L is a Global Equities fund tracking the MSCI World Enhanced Value Index. Both are passively managed. Over the past 10 years, 8PSB.DE returned 11.06%/yr vs 13.53%/yr for IWVL.L. At a 0.12 correlation, their price movements are largely independent. 8PSB.DE charges 0.19%/yr vs 0.25%/yr for IWVL.L.

8PSB.DE vs. IWVL.L - Expense Ratio Comparison
8PSB.DE has a 0.19% expense ratio, which is lower than IWVL.L's 0.25% expense ratio. Despite the difference, both funds are considered low-cost compared to the broader market, where average expense ratios usually range from 0.3% to 0.9%.
